Video Fraud Detection using Blockchain
Abstract
This paper has considered the problem of Video Fraudulence, i.e., attackers can tamper with the original video and can create a fake video of their own. This problem is of great practical importance given the massive volume of online videos available through the World Wide Web, Internet news feeds, electronic mail, corporate databases, and digital libraries. To the best of our knowledge, no such video fraud detection algorithm has been proposed in the literature that can detect, using Blockchain, whether the video has been tampered with. This paper is a comparative study and provides a prototype of how it applies Blockchain to detect video fraudulence. The focus is on the usability of Blockchain and how to implement it to get the desired result. Three features of Blockchain that are Decentralization, Data transparency, and Security and privacy are being used to provide a reliable solution. Some cryptographic algorithms are used to find unique feature in all of the videos that can act as the hash value of the video because, in Blockchains, every node stores the data in the form of the hash value. If the video is tampered with, then the hash value changes and hence any fraud in the video can be detected.
